SC serves notices to Dar, others for appearance in Qasmi appointment case

07 Jul, 2018

ISLAMABAD: The Supreme Court has served notices to the then Federal Minister for Finance Ishaq Dar, the then Federal Secretary Information Muhammad Azam, and the then Secretary Finance Waqar Masood for appearance on July 9 on account of approving salary, perks and privileges of Ata-ul-Haq Qasmi in official capacity.

According to a notification issued on Saturday, the SC directed that summons to Ishaq Dar be issued and affixed at his permanent residence in Lahore as he is reportedly gone abroad.

The Supreme Court passed the order on July 5, in Case No 3654 of 2018 relating to appointment of Ata-ul-Haq Qasmi as Managing Director of Pakistan Television Corporation (PTV).
